Picard: "Fermat's last theorem. When Pierre de Fermat died they found this equation scrawled in the margin of his notes. X to the nth plus Y to the nth equals Z to the nth, where n is greater than 2, which he said had no solution in whole numbers. But he also added this phrase. Remarkable proof."

Riker: "There was no proof included."

Picard: "For the eight hundred years people have been trying to solve it."

Riker: "Including you."

Picard: "I find it stimulating. Also, it puts things in perspective. In our arrogance we feel we are so advanced, and yet we cannot unravel a simple knot tied by a part-time French mathematician working alone, without a computer."

Riker: "None of it makes any sense."

Picard: "Like Fermat's theorem, it's a puzzle we may never solve."



While in the advanced Star Trek Universe, Fermat's last theorem is still a brainteaser, in our universe it has been solved in 1994 by British mathematician Sir Andrew Wiles.
